Regulatory mechanisms of the Sin Quorum Sensing System and its impact on survival of the soil-dwelling bacterium Sinorhizobium meliloti

The Sin Quorum Sensing (QS) system of the soil bacterium Sinorhizobium meliloti controls genes involved in a variety of cellular processes such as exopolysaccharide (EPS) production, motility, nitrogen fixation, and transport of metals and small molecules.
